What is Adult ADHD?
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ental condition that manifests as a mix of relentless neg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. While these symptoms can be obvious in childhood, many individuals continue to experience them into their adult years. According to the American Psychiatric Association, ADHD can result in numerous problems, consisting of troubles in relationships, work obstacles, and issues with time management.
Common Symptoms of Adult ADHD
Adult ADHD symptoms may vary from those observed in kids. People with adult ADHD might often experience:
Inattention: Difficulty sustaining attention, trouble arranging tasks, and regular distractions.Hyperactivity: A sensation of uneasyness, excessive talking, or problem taking part in quiet activities.Impulsivity: Making hasty choices, interrupting others, and problem waiting on one's turn.

Testing is crucial for a comprehensive understanding of whether an adult might have ADHD. A number of aspects contribute to the significance of expert examination:

Accurate Diagnosis: ADHD shares symptoms with other conditions such as stress and anxiety, depression, and learning specials needs. Through testing, healthcare experts can supply a precise diagnosis.

Customized Interventions: Once a correct medical diagnosis is established, targeted interventions and treatment strategies can be developed.

Improved Quality of Life: Understanding ADHD symptoms permits the specific to embrace coping strategies and lower potential negative impacts on their work and individual life.
Types of Tests for Adult ADHD
Adults can be evaluated for ADHD through different methods, including:
Clinical Interview
A comprehensive medical interview with a psychological health professional is the most typical preliminary action in the diagnostic process. This consists of:
An in-depth individual historyFamily history of ADHD or associated conditionsAssessment of symptoms based on recognized diagnostic requirementsSelf-Report Questionnaires
Self-report questionnaires can be important tools in determining ADHD symptoms. Some commonly utilized questionnaires include:

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S): This tool consists of a series of concerns to identify the possibility of ADHD symptoms.

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scales (CAARS): This might include thorough ratings on different aspects of behavior and working over the past few months.
Behavioral Observations
Behavioral observations can likewise supply insights into a person's challenges with attention, organization, and impulse control. This may include feedback from relative, friends, or coworkers relating to particular habits that indicate ADHD symptoms.
FAQ Section1. How is adult ADHD diagnosed?
Diagnosis is made through a detailed evaluation process that consists of medical interviews, self-report questionnaires, and behavioral observations.
2. What are the treatment alternatives for adult ADHD?
Treatment alternatives might include:
Medication: Stimulants and non-stimulants are frequently prescribed.Treatment: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) and therapy can help handle symptoms.Way of life Changes: Incorporating exercise, a balanced diet plan, and time management techniques can be advantageous.3. Can adult ADHD be misinterpreted for other conditions?
Yes, adult ADHD shares symptoms with other mental health conditions, including stress and anxiety, depression, and bipolar disorder, making precise medical diagnosis necessary.
4. How common is adult ADHD?
Research shows that around 2.5% of adults in the U.S. have ADHD, although lots of remain undiagnosed.
